背景情况:
- 在全球范围内被广泛消费,有食用品种和有毒品种.
- 从形态上区分有毒和食用往往是不可能的,导致意外中毒.
- 毒素会引起各种临床综合征,从轻微的胃肠道乱到致命的结果.

主要成果:
- 环胺毒素与90%以上的致命中毒有关.
- 阿曼尼塔化物 (Amanita phalloides) 是致命的摄入的主要原因.
- 各种毒素会引起不同的临床综合征,需要特定的诊断和治疗方法.

The scientific method is a detailed, empirical problem-solving process used by biologists and other scientists. This iterative approach involves formulating a question based on observation, developing a testable potential explanation for the observation (called a hypothesis), making and testing predictions based on the hypothesis, and using the findings to create new hypotheses and predictions.
